Star Rating - TAFE NSW Riverina Institute (Albury Campus)
Riverina Institute in Albury, receiving a two gold-star rating for Automotive, is helping to address the national skills shortage by offering a broad range of training across the traditional trade areas.
In the Automotive industry, training is offered in both light and heavy vehicle mechanical; automotive electrical; panel beating and spray painting; and advanced technologies. Ongoing training for qualified tradespeople to meet legislative requirements or become well-versed on the latest techniques and technologies is also offered.
